Skip to main content
Announcements
Have questions about Qlik Connect? Join us live on April 10th, at 11 AM ET: SIGN UP NOW
cancel
Showing results for 
Search instead for 
Did you mean: 
ronanseleme
Contributor III
Contributor III

Relacionamento de Dados

Boa tarde,

Estou fazendo o LOAD de uma base, perfeito funcionou e ela esta trazendo a base corretamente.

Agora preciso fazer com que apenas o campo "Total_Horas" apenas apareça em outra base já cadastrada o campo de vinculação da outra base é o 'Numero_Ordem'.

Horas_Novo: LOAD

  Empresa_BUKRS as Empresa,

  Centro_WERKS as Centro,

  [Classe de custo_KSTAR] as ClOrdem,

  Exercício_GJAHR as Ano,

  [Momento da criação_TIMESTMP],

  [Nº documento_BELNR] as Num_Doc,

  mid([Nº objeto_OBJNR],5,12) as Numero_Ordem,

  [Objeto de origem_USPOB],

  [Quantidade total_MEGBTR] as Total_Horas,

  [Unidade de medida_MEINH] as UM

FROM $(CAMINHO2)QVD_QCOEP_3_Partidas_CO.qvd (qvd)

  Where [Classe de custo_KSTAR]='ALOC_HM';

5 Replies
Marcio_Campestrini
Specialist
Specialist

Boa tarde

Está estranha a sua necessidade?

Você quer que a informação desse load seja ligada em outra tabela? Se sim, basta fazer um Left Join com a tabela principal, ligando os campos de chave e adicionando o campo Total_Horas.

Se não for isso, por gentileza melhore a sua descrição do problema.

Márcio Rodrigo Campestrini
mauroponte
Creator II
Creator II

Ronan,

Pelo que entendi voce precisa fazer o seguinte:

1-carregar o load que voce mensionou.

2-Em seguida fazer o load da segunnda_tabela, acrescentando um left join com os dois campos Total_Horas e Numero_Ordem assim:

        

          left join(Nome da Segunda Tabela)

          Load

                    Numero_Ordem,

                    Total_Horas               AS Segunda_Tabela.Total_Horas

          Resident Horas_Novo;

A clausula "AS" no join é para que as duas tabelas não fiquem com o mesmo nome de campo, pois isso faria com que o Qlik entendesse esse campo como chave entre as duas tabelas, o que poderia gerar uma ligação indevida ou uma chave sintética.

Acredito que isso atenda a sua necessidade.

Espero ter ajudado.

Marcio_Campestrini
Specialist
Specialist

Ronan

Conseguiu resolver o problema? Se sim, marque as respostas como Corretas/Úteis para auxiliar a manter a comunidade organizada

Márcio Rodrigo Campestrini
Marcio_Campestrini
Specialist
Specialist

Conseguiu resolver seu problema? Marque as respostas como úteis/correta para fechar o tópico e mantermos a comunidade organizada.

Márcio Rodrigo Campestrini
mario_sergio_ti
Partner - Specialist
Partner - Specialist

Referência (Tópicos 2.3 e 2.4): Manual do usuário | Como criar e gerir minhas perguntas?

Abraço.

Consultor certificado | Quem compartilha, aprende!
https://www.linkedin.com/in/mariosergioti